im from burma 🙂 try this out. “Burmese Curried Pork” INGREDIENTS: 2 Pounds Pork — cubed 1 Large Onion — chopped 5 Cloves Garlic — minced 1 Tablespoon Ginger Root — chopped 1 Teaspoon Turmeric 1/2 Teaspoon Red Pepper 2 Tablespoons Olive Oil 1 Teaspoon Sesame Oil 1 Can Stewed Tomatoes — chopped 1 Stalk Lemon Grass — chopped 1 Tablespoon Fish Sauce 2 Cups Rice — cooked METHOD Directions Place onion, garlic, ginger root, turmeric and red pepper in blender and a drop of olive oil (just enough to moisten). Cover and blend until smooth, 1 minutes. Heat oil in dutch oven, then pour blender mixture into oil (may spatter a bit). Cover and simmer for 15 minutes. Add remaining ingredients, boil. Reduce heat, cover & simmer 1 1/2 hours. Serve over rice. (Serves: 4) ive made it a couple of times when guests were over and its lovely.
